Formula 1 – Mike Krak: Why is Fernando Alonso a step above Sebastian Vettel?

Fernando Alonso will begin his first season with the Formula 1 Aston Martin crew in 2023, changing Sebastian Vettel, who has retired. Team principal Mike Craque believes the Spaniard is nonetheless probably the greatest drivers in Formula 1 regardless of his superior age at 41, and that Aston Martin, however, can present him with the fitting automotive.

In an interview with the Spanish publication “AS”, Krak talked in regards to the crew’s ambitions, but in addition about Alonso, who may take Aston Martin to a new stage.

Asked the place Alonso at the moment stands within the Formula 1 rankings primarily based on driving efficiency alone, Krak replied: “If everybody was driving the identical automotive, he could be on the entrance.”

“The predominant activity now is to present Fernando a automotive able to this. If we get it out, he’ll put it in the fitting place,” assured Krak.

Crack: ‘Fernando’s starvation drives us ahead’

According to statistics, 4-time Formula 1 world champion Sebastian Vettel had a good contract driver final 12 months. Therefore, the Aston Martin crew boss was left questioning why the signing of Alonso was highlighted as the following step.

“That’s a good query,” Luxemburg replies. “Because Seb is a 4-time world champion. But he is a completely different individual, he determined to retire and Fernando determined to proceed longer. It modifications the motivation of the crew.”

“The crew has that dynamic. We’re grateful for what Sebastian has introduced in, he is taken the crew to a different stage, however the mixture of funding behind him and Fernando’s starvation will push us to make much more progress,” he explains.

Slide: Other groups do not take it properly sufficient

The Silverstone crew shall be eager to bounce again from two consecutive seventh-place finishes within the Constructors’ Championship and transfer up the grid as rapidly as attainable. While there are different midfield groups with large ambitions, resembling Alpine and McLaren, Krak factors out that Aston Martin must be reckoned with.

“We take it extra severely and our ambitions are strong,” he says when requested which crew is the fitting wager. “No one within the business has invested in getting there. Three years from now, sure, there are groups that say they’ll win a hundred races, however what are they doing to win?”

“With the manufacturing facility, the wind tunnel, the brand new simulators, we’re critical, there is a large funding behind it. Goals for 2023? Crack retains a low profile

Aston Martin ought to due to this fact take the primary step in the fitting route subsequent season by enjoying a key position within the entrance midfield, because it did in 2020 – then nonetheless beneath the Racing Point identify.

However, when requested in regards to the targets for 2023, Krak stated: “Before the summer time break [haben wir uns auf das 2023er-Auto konzentriert]. The work began earlier than that, however most significantly, it began a few weeks earlier than the summer time trip.”

“We need to go up as quickly as attainable. It’s very straightforward to speak about it and it is very straightforward to say whether or not we’ll do that or that. But Formula 1 is unpredictable. It’s a relative sport. With all of the progress we’re making, if all of the groups make that progress , we are going to stay the place we have been.”

“We should go additional than others. In 2022 we began from a low stage and it was very tough to remain in midfield. We need to begin 2023 from a higher base as a result of with the funds ceiling you can not afford to begin badly. Every step you attempt to make is very costly. We We have been seventh in 2021, seventh in 2022 and we’ve to go from there.”

“All the Formula 1 groups are at a very excessive stage,” he added. “In 2022, the automobiles had extra weight, completely different aerodynamic ideas. With these guidelines, it will likely be simpler to go in the fitting route a 12 months from now. However, not everybody will make the identical progress.”
